Reasoning About Resources in the Embedded Systems Language Hume
نویسندگان
چکیده
In this paper we present an instrumented program logic for the embedded systems language Hume, suitable to reason about resource consumption. Matching the structure of Hume programs, it integrates two logics, a VDM-style program logic for the functional language and a TLA-style logic for the coordination language of Hume. We present a soundness proof of the program logic, and demonstrate the usability of these logics by proving resource bounds for a Hume program. Both logics, the soundness proof and the example have been fully formalised in the Isabelle/HOL theorem prover.
